Those who enjoy a distraction-free experience have the handy Full-Screen toggle right at the top right of the window. Finally the Settings tab enables you to manage your account and tweak some preferences, such as the default downloads folder for all your games, toggling the news notifications on and off, and much more. Support offers even more help, including knowledge base articles and a list of frequently asked questions. Community includes a handy forum, polls, links to social networks, and a very reliable chat system where you can contact the administrators to troubleshoot any issues that may arise during use. You then have My Games, which lists all your purchases, demos, and in-progress downloads, followed by the News tab, which lists the latest game releases, pre-orders, specials, reviews, game updates, and the developers’ blog. Clicking a title takes you straight to the description, screenshots, system requirements and, of course, the download. Just like Apple’s solution, the Mac Game Store offers a reeling preview banner that displays the latest / most popular additions. The Store tab is the main destination for anyone looking to see what’s new at a glance. Mac Game Store features a three-pane window with the individual services on the left, and their expanded features on the right. Everything that the Mac supports gets added to the growing list of titles on a daily basis, and the download experience couldn’t be more intuitive. Using the standard App Store system pioneered by Apple (and Valve), Mac Game Store is a digital distribution system focused solely on games.
